6.2 Holiday Touchdown: A Bills Love Story Nov. 22, 2025 Holiday Touchdown: A Bills Love Story IMDb: 6.2 2025 84 min 2 views The Quinns and DeLucas have lived next door to each other for decades in the shadow of Highmark Stadium – the home of their beloved Buffalo ... ComedyFamilyRomance